Severe Thunderstorm Warning
National Weather Service Indianapolis IN
1249 PM EDT Tue Aug 11 2026

The National Weather Service in Indianapolis has issued a

* Severe Thunderstorm Warning for...
  Carroll County in north central Indiana...
  Tippecanoe County in west central Indiana...
  Northern Clinton County in central Indiana...
  Western Howard County in central Indiana...

* Until 145 PM EDT.

* At 1249 PM EDT, severe thunderstorms were located along a line
  extending from 9 miles west of Royal Center to 6 miles west of
  Monticello to near Remington, moving southeast at 55 mph.

  HAZARD...60 mph wind gusts and quarter size hail.

  SOURCE...Radar indicated.

  IMPACT...Hail damage to vehicles is expected. Expect wind damage 
           to roofs, siding, and trees.

* Locations impacted include...
  Lafayette, Frankfort, West Lafayette, Delphi, Flora, Rossville,
  Shadeland, Dayton, Battle Ground, Mulberry, Camden, Burlington,
  Michigantown, Yeoman, and Purdue University.

This includes Interstate 65 between mile markers 159 and 184.
 
P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

For your protection move to an interior room on the lowest floor of a
building.

Torrential rainfall is occurring with these storms, and may lead to
flash flooding. Do not drive your vehicle through flooded roadways.
